Here's a look back at how she unexpectedly became one of the most recognisable faces of early 2000s Indian pop culture.
In a past interview with digital platform HerZindagi, Jariwala had shared the story of how she was discovered. 'It was not a struggle for me at all,' she recalled. 'I was standing outside my college with some friends when the directors of Kaanta Laga, Radhika Rao and Vinay Sapru, spotted me.'

She initially thought it was a prank. 'I come from a very academic family. So, it was very impossible for me that how will I get permission at home for this,' she said.

Convincing her parents, she admitted, wasn't easy. 'I laugh a lot today when thinking about it... because what did we not do to convince my parents. Somehow our directors convinced my father,' she had said.
What followed was a cultural moment that defined the remix era in Indian pop music. 'I didn't expect that it will be an overnight success and my whole life changed. For me, it was like that,' she had reflected.

New Delhi: Actress Shefali Jariwala, best known for her appearance on Bigg Boss 13 and the hit remix of the song Kaanta Laga, died on Friday (June 27). She was 42. Shefali reportedly suffered a cardiac arrest at her Mumbai residence. Shefali's husband, actor Parag Tyagi, rushed her to the hospital, where doctors declared her dead on arrival. Who was Shefali Jariwala? Born on December 15, 1982, in Mumbai, Shefali Jariwala rose to fame with her bold and captivating presence in one of the biggest remix songs of the 2000s, Kaanta Laga. Her career spanned over two decades, during which she appeared in several Hindi music videos, reality shows and movies. Apart from the Kaanta Laga music video, Shefali featured in songs like Sweet Honey Mix and Kabhi Aar Kabhi Paar Remix. The actress made her Bollywood debut in the 2004 film Mujhse Shaadi Karogi, starring Salman Khan, Akshay Kumar and Priyanka Chopra. She had a limited role in the movie, which is the extent of her Bollywood career. However, she later starred in a 2011 Kannada release called Hudaguru. Shefali Jariwala also participated in Nach Baliye 5 and Nach Baliye 7 with her husband, Parag Tyagi. She also made a striking appearance in Bigg Boss 13. In 2018, the actress played the female lead in ALT Balaji's web series Baby Come Naa opposite Shreyas Talpade. Shefali Jariwala married Harmeet Singh of Meet Brothers fame in 2004. They parted ways in 2009. The actress met Parag Tyagi at a friend's dinner party in 2010. They dated for four years before sealing their union in 2014. Shefali was a graduate with a degree in Computer Applications from Sardar Patel College of Engineering. She also bravely battled epilepsy since she was 15. Summer has officially arrived, and so has Brad Pitt, making a high-octane return with his much-anticipated film F1: The Movie, which opened to impressive numbers across Indian theatres. According to industry tracker Sacnilk, the film earned approximately Rs 5.25 crore net on its first day (Friday), across all languages. The English 2D version posted an overall occupancy of 27.82% on its opening day. The film began modestly with 13.93% occupancy during the morning shows, gained momentum to reach 27.14% in the afternoon, rose further to 28.35% in the evening, and peaked at 41.84% during the night shows. Regionally, Chennai led with a strong 43% occupancy, followed closely by Hyderabad at 40.75% and Kochi at 31.75%. Surprisingly, key metropolitan markets like Mumbai and Delhi lagged behind, recording only 22.25% and 20.5% occupancy, respectively. Among the premium formats, English 4DX registered the highest occupancy across all languages and formats at 68%, followed by English IMAX at 58.57%, and English ICE at 39.94%. Also Read | F1 movie review: Film leaves you wanting more Formula 1, and more Brad Pitt While F1: The Movie is generating significant buzz and audience anticipation, it still fell short of surpassing the opening day record of Mission: Impossible – The Final Reckoning, which had collected Rs 16.5 crore on day one. However, Pitt's latest outing did outperform other recent major Hollywood releases in India. It beat Karate Kid Legends, starring Jackie Chan, which opened with Rs 1.75 crore, and his own previous film Bullet Train, which collected Rs 0.45 crore on its first day. The film features Brad Pitt as a veteran race-car driver who returns to Formula One after three decades to revive a struggling team and save his former teammate's legacy. Directed by Joseph Kosinski, best known for the global blockbuster Top Gun: Maverick, F1 has already surpassed Top Gun: Maverick's Indian opening day numbers, which stood at Rs 4.89 crore. With largely positive reviews and soaring audience interest, all eyes are now on how F1: The Movie performs in the coming days. However, its box office run will be tested by competition from regional releases such as Sitaare Zameen Par, Maa, and Kannappa.
